水泥施工素材视频下载软件如何开发?功能设计与技术实现详解
在建筑行业数字化转型的浪潮中,高质量的施工素材视频已成为项目管理、技术培训和宣传展示的重要工具。尤其对于水泥施工这类专业性强、工艺复杂的工程环节,一套专门用于收集、整理和下载相关视频素材的软件系统,能够极大提升工作效率与专业度。那么,如何开发一款功能完善、用户体验良好的水泥施工素材视频下载软件?本文将从需求分析、核心功能设计、技术架构选型、数据处理策略到市场推广路径进行深度剖析,为开发者和建筑企业提供实用参考。
一、市场需求与痛点分析
当前,建筑企业、施工单位、监理单位及培训机构对水泥施工过程中的实拍视频素材需求日益增长。这些视频可用于:
- 新员工岗前培训(如混凝土浇筑、养护、模板拆除等关键节点)
- 施工现场标准化管理可视化展示
- 工程项目验收资料归档
- 社交媒体平台的内容输出(如抖音、B站、微信视频号)
然而,现有市场上的通用视频下载工具(如浏览器插件、第三方APP)存在明显不足:
- 内容不垂直:无法精准识别并提取水泥施工类视频资源
- 格式兼容性差:下载后的视频可能因编码问题无法直接用于剪辑或播放
- 无分类标签体系:缺乏按“施工阶段”、“工艺类型”、“设备型号”等维度进行结构化管理的能力
- 隐私与版权风险:未提供合法来源验证机制,易引发法律纠纷
因此,开发一款专注于水泥施工领域的专业化视频素材下载软件,具有明确的市场价值与现实意义。
二、核心功能模块设计
一个优秀的水泥施工素材视频下载软件应包含以下五大核心功能模块:
1. 智能爬取与聚合引擎
利用网络爬虫技术,对接主流建筑类网站、短视频平台(如抖音建筑话题、快手工地记录)、专业论坛(如筑龙网、中国建筑学会官网)等,自动抓取与水泥施工相关的视频资源。关键能力包括:
- 基于关键词匹配(如“混凝土浇筑”、“水泥搅拌站”、“泵车作业”)过滤无效内容
- 支持多平台API接入(如抖音开放平台接口),提升爬取效率与合规性
- 建立视频元数据索引(标题、发布时间、拍摄地点、设备信息)
2. 视频解析与转码服务
针对不同来源的视频文件进行智能解析与格式转换,确保用户可直接使用。主要功能:
- 自动识别视频编码格式(H.264/H.265/AV1),统一转码为MP4(H.264)标准格式
- 支持分辨率适配(原画、高清、标清)以适应不同设备播放需求
- 嵌入水印标识(可选)用于版权保护和来源追踪
3. 结构化标签管理系统
这是区别于普通下载工具的核心亮点。通过AI图像识别+人工标注双模式,对每段视频打上细粒度标签:
- 一级标签:施工阶段(基础施工、主体结构、装饰装修)
- 二级标签:工艺类型(钢筋绑扎、模板安装、混凝土振捣)
- 三级标签:设备名称(搅拌车、泵车、振动棒)
- 四级标签:安全要点(佩戴安全帽、高空作业防护)
用户可通过多级筛选快速定位所需素材,极大提升检索效率。
4. 本地缓存与云端同步
支持两种存储模式:
- 本地缓存:适合离线环境使用,节省带宽成本
- 云端备份:提供企业级云空间(如阿里云OSS),防止数据丢失,并支持团队协作共享
同时具备版本控制功能,便于回溯历史素材变更。
5. 用户权限与审计日志
面向企业用户,需内置完善的权限管理体系:
- 角色分级(管理员、项目经理、普通员工)
- 操作留痕(谁在何时下载了哪段视频)
- 敏感词过滤(防止误下载非法内容)
三、技术架构与实现方案
1. 前端技术栈选择
推荐采用React + Ant Design Pro框架构建Web界面,兼顾性能与开发效率。移动端可用Flutter跨平台开发,确保iOS和Android体验一致。
2. 后端服务架构
建议采用微服务架构,拆分为以下模块:
- 爬虫调度中心(Python + Scrapy)
- 视频处理服务(FFmpeg + Docker容器化部署)
- 标签识别引擎(基于OpenCV+YOLOv8目标检测模型)
- 用户认证与权限服务(JWT + RBAC模型)
- 数据存储层(MySQL + Redis + MinIO对象存储)
3. AI辅助标签生成方案
为降低人工标注成本,引入轻量级AI模型:
- 训练专用语义模型识别水泥施工场景关键词(如“水泥浆”、“塌落度测试”)
- 结合视频帧截图进行物体识别(识别出塔吊、泵车、工人行为)
- 最终输出结构化JSON标签数据供前端调用
四、数据处理与质量保障
为了保证素材库的专业性和实用性,必须建立严格的数据审核机制:
- 初筛机制:自动剔除重复视频、低清晰度片段、非施工类内容(如广告、无关活动)
- 人工复核:设立专业编辑团队,定期抽查视频内容是否符合规范
- 用户反馈闭环:允许用户标记错误标签或缺失内容,持续优化算法模型
此外,还需考虑数据更新频率——建议每周至少更新一次新素材,保持数据库活力。
五、商业模式与推广策略
1. 商业模式探索
可采取以下几种盈利方式:
- 基础版免费:提供有限数量的视频下载额度(每月50条)
- 企业订阅制:按年付费(如¥2999/年),解锁全部功能与无限下载
- 定制化服务:为企业量身打造专属素材库(如某央企项目专项视频集)
2. 推广路径建议
重点面向以下渠道进行精准投放:
- 建筑行业协会合作(如中国建筑业协会)
- 建筑类App导流(如建联、筑龙网、造价通)
- 短视频平台营销(在抖音发布“水泥施工教学短视频”,引导点击下载链接)
- 线下展会参展(如上海国际建筑工业化展)
同时鼓励用户生成UGC内容(上传自己的施工视频并打标签),形成良性生态循环。
六、未来发展方向
随着AI与建筑信息化深度融合,该软件可进一步拓展应用场景:
- 集成AR/VR功能,实现沉浸式施工教学体验
- 接入BIM模型,实现视频与三维模型联动展示
- 开发小程序版本,方便现场工人扫码即用
- 探索区块链技术用于素材版权确权与溯源
总之,一款专业的水泥施工素材视频下载软件不仅是工具,更是推动建筑行业知识沉淀与传播的重要载体。它让每一个施工细节都变得可视、可学、可传承。